-package sun.misc;
-
-/**
- * The CRC-16 class calculates a 16 bit cyclic redundancy check of a set
- * of bytes. This error detecting code is used to determine if bit rot
- * has occurred in a byte stream.
- */
-
-public class CRC16 {
-
-    /** value contains the currently computed CRC, set it to 0 initally */
-    public int value;
-
-    public CRC16() {
-        value = 0;
-    }
-
-    /** update CRC with byte b */
-    public void update(byte aByte) {
-        int a, b;
-
-        a = (int) aByte;
-        for (int count = 7; count >=0; count--) {
-            a = a << 1;
-            b = (a >>> 8) & 1;
-            if ((value & 0x8000) != 0) {
-                value = ((value << 1) + b) ^ 0x1021;
-            } else {
-                value = (value << 1) + b;
-            }
-        }
-        value = value & 0xffff;
-        return;
-    }
-
-    /** reset CRC value to 0 */
-    public void reset() {
-        value = 0;
-    }
-}
